Where Does the Name Marie Come From?

Marie is, essentially, a form of the feminine name Maria. It has its earliest beginnings in the Hebrew name Miriam, which is pretty fascinating, honestly. So, in a way, its roots go back a very long time, to ancient times, as a matter of fact.

It's also the usual form of the name in Czech, and it's used in other places, too. People use it as a different way to say Mary or Maria, or sometimes it's just borrowed from French. This shows how widely it has traveled, you know, across different languages and cultures.

The name Marie is, of course, a French form of Mary. It has been incredibly common in France for a very long time, since the 13th century, to be exact. This means it has been a staple in French naming traditions for many hundreds of years, basically.

In England, people have also used Marie, sometimes as a French borrowing. Or, it could be, they used it as another version of Mary. This just shows how names can move around and change a little bit as they get adopted by different communities, you know.

What Does Marie Actually Mean?

The meaning of the name Marie is, interestingly enough, a bit varied. It's not just one single meaning, which makes it rather unique, you know. One common interpretation is "drop of the sea," which paints a rather lovely picture, doesn't it?

Another meaning often associated with Marie is "bitter." This might seem a little different from "drop of the sea," but names can sometimes have multiple layers of meaning, depending on their linguistic journey, so.

And then, there's also the meaning "beloved." This interpretation, of course, gives the name a very warm and affectionate feel. It's pretty amazing how one name can hold such different, yet equally powerful, meanings, isn't that something?

Specifically, information from sources like Babynames.com suggests that the name Marie, primarily a female name of French origin, means "of the sea" or "bitter." These meanings are, arguably, the most widely recognized ones today, at the end of the day.

Marie's Journey Through History and Culture

The name Marie has, quite frankly, a very significant place in history and culture. It's not just a name; it carries a lot of weight, especially because of its connection to the Virgin Mary in Christianity. This link gives it a very deep spiritual meaning for many people, basically.

Because of this strong association, Marie is a name that people revere. It's honored for its historical importance and its spiritual weight, too it's almost like a symbol of faith for many, you know. This is a big part of why it has stayed so prominent for so long, seriously.

Back at the start of the 20th century, Marie was given to a huge number of French babies, about 20 percent, as a matter of fact. This shows just how incredibly popular it was, a true favorite for many families, you know. It was, arguably, a household name in the truest sense.

The name Marie, with its deep roots and rich background, actually comes from the French version of Mary. And Mary itself, as we touched on, comes from the Hebrew name Miriam. So, you can see how it's like a family tree of names, with each branch connecting to an older one, pretty much.
